During a recession, how people shop and spend money changes a lot. Here are some key points:
Cutting Back on Spending: People start to buy less stuff that isn't necessary. They focus more on things they really need.
Saving Money: People pay more attention to saving their money. They feel unsure about the economy and want to be careful.
Looking for Deals: Shoppers start caring more about prices. They search for sales and discounts to get better deals.
Choosing Cheaper Brands: Many people decide to buy generic brands instead of name brands. This helps them save money.
In short, during tough economic times, folks become more careful and make smarter choices with their money!
